[edit] Events
- 1 May: 2004 Enlargement.
- 10-13 June: European Parliament election, 2004 expanding the Commission.
- 22 July; Parliament approves José Manuel Barroso as President.
- 1 November: Original date for Barroso to enter office delayed due to parliamentary opposition to some of his Commissioners. A new college is later submitted.
- 18 November: Parliament approves the Barroso Commission.
- 22 November: Barroso Commission took office.
